Output 10663bfb2422f420e4e5317a6785b8b9f3f7ddff146f95287753fba5dbc0def8:1

value
1201240
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50b2a110538ce3d6f9b70795501aa6829670d1ef OP_EQUALVERIFY OP_CHECKSIG
address
18Mh3idTebJ9QrM5iEXFMTPYsv8UzJQNA3
transaction
10663bfb2422f420e4e5317a6785b8b9f3f7ddff146f95287753fba5dbc0def8
spent
true